    Plan for lane restrictions on SR 179 near I-17 starting Aug. 9

    Arizona Department of TransporationSedona AZ (August 7, 2021) – The Arizona Department of Transportation is advising motorists to plan for delays due to daytime lane restrictions along a six-mile stretch of State Route 179 north of Interstate 17 starting on Monday, Aug. 9, as crews perform maintenance on the roadway. The work will continue on weekdays through Friday, Sept. 10.

    Drivers should slow down, proceed through the work zone with caution and watch for construction personnel and equipment while the following restrictions are in place from 7 a.m. to 4 p.m. (2 p.m. on Fridays):

    • SR 179 will be restricted to one lane only of alternating north- and southbound travel from milepost 299 to 305.
    • Work will be performed in 1.25-mile segments.
    • Drivers should be prepared to stop.
    • Flaggers and a pilot car will direct motorists through the work zone.
    • The speed limit will be reduced to 25 mph.

    Schedules are subject to change based on weather and other unforeseen factors.
